RCB Set To Sign George Garton For IPL 2021: Reports
As per reports, RCB is set to sign George Garton For IPL 2021. The left-arm pacer from England will replace Kane Richardson, who has been ruled out of the tournament. The UAE-leg of the competition will happen from September 19th. RCB’s first opponents in the second phase will be KKR.

Left-handed English player, George Garton may get a chance to debut in IPL this season.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) recently announced their new team members (Dushmantha Chameera, Wanindu Hasaranga, Tim David) as they are replacing Kane Richardson, Adam Zampa, Daniel Sams, Fin Allen, and Scott Kuggeleijn for the remaining matches.
The report suggests that the Englishman’s inclusion is only pending approval from the IPL governing council. 24-year-old medium-fast bowler, George Garton recently played for Southern Brave In The Hundred Men’s Competition and has been very impressive throughout the league. In T20 Internationals, he has taken 43 wickets in 37 matches with an economy of 8.15.

George Garton is a 24-year-old left-arm pacer from England. He represented the Southern Brave, the team that won the inaugural edition of the Hundred. In fact, he was one of the most important players to help the side lift the trophy. In the finals, the player opened the bowling for his side and bowled 20 balls to give away just 27 runs. He took the wicket of David Bedingham in the final. The catch-taker was Tim David, incidentally another new RCB signing.
